Diaries¶
Development of sire is an ongoing process involving many people.
This section of the documentation is a collection of diary-style
blog posts that describe the development of sire and
new features as they are added.
What’s in a file? Using sire search¶
In this first post, written around the 2023.1 release,
we describe the sire search
functionality that enables sire to act like a molecular information
search engine.
Working with RDKit¶
In this second post, written around the 2023.2 release,
we show how integration with RDKit
enables sire to work with SMILES strings and RDKit molecules.
Working with OpenMM¶
In this third post, also written around the 2023.2 release,
we show how integration with OpenMM
enables sire to perform GPU-accelerated molecular dynamics simulations.
GPU-accelerated free energies¶
In this fourth post, written around the 2023.4 release, we show how the OpenMM integration has been extended to enable the calculation of free energies.
